Explore the science behind modern agriculture with this comprehensive high school homeschool Crop Science course. Designed as a secular, college-prep agricultural science curriculum, this full-year course gives students an in-depth understanding of crop production, plant science, soil management, sustainability, and modern farming systems through research, critical thinking, and analysis-based learning.

This high school Crop Science homeschool course challenges students to investigate real-world agricultural issues while building valuable research, writing, and analytical skills. Students explore plant biology, soil science, crop management, agricultural technology, genetics, pest control, environmental sustainability, and food production systems through projects, research assignments, case studies, and critical thinking activities.

Perfect for homeschool families seeking a rigorous agriculture elective, this course helps prepare students for college-level science coursework, agricultural studies, environmental science programs, and future careers in farming, agribusiness, agronomy, plant science, and STEM fields.

Students learn how science, technology, economics, and environmental factors shape modern agriculture while developing the ability to evaluate evidence, analyze agricultural practices, and think critically about global food systems and sustainability challenges.

Topics Covered in Crop Science:

  • Plant biology and plant science
  • Soil science and soil health
  • Crop production and management
  • Sustainable agriculture
  • Agricultural technology and innovation
  • Plant genetics and breeding
  • Pest, weed, and disease management
  • Food production systems
  • Environmental impacts of agriculture
  • Agribusiness and agricultural careers
